Chemical Addictions Recovery Effort (CARE) Inc. is a non-profit agency in Panama City, Florida providing prevention, intervention, treatment, and recovery services for substance use disorders across six counties in Northwest Florida (Bay, Calhoun, Gulf, Holmes, Jackson, and Washington). CARE offers a full range of licensed services for all age groups, including treatment for co-occurring disorders. The agency integrates involvement with Alcoholics Anonymous, Narcotics Anonymous, and other support groups as an integral part of treatment. CARE works with individuals and their families, recognizing that chemical addiction affects loved ones as much as the person with the disease. Services are coordinated with community organizations and the agency is licensed by and operates in accordance with Florida Department of Children and Families regulations.
